Run Home To Me

The wind stings against your back

Your feet are going numb.

You're hungry, and you're tired

Run home to me

I know what you did

And I know how you feel

So I forgive you

Run home to me

What you did was bad, I agree

But others have done worse

You're young, you have a lot to learn

Run home to me

I don't understand why you keep fighting my love.

I give you forgiveness, you just turn away

I give you understanding, and you run away

Stop fighting, and run home to me

By Louise
